Carnegie stage 11
Introduction
Facts
Week 4, 23 - 26 days, 2.5 - 4.5 mm, Somite Number 13 - 20
Events
Ectoderm: Neural tube continues to close, Rostral neuropore closes
Mesoderm: continued segmentation of paraxial mesoderm (13 - 20 somite pairs), heart tube bending
Features
rostral neuropore closing, forebrain, neural tube in region of developing spinal cord, somites, caudal neuropore, connecting stalk, amnion
